While related to life-orientation measures of optimism, attributional style [ clarification needed] theory suggests that dispositional optimism and pessimism are reflections of the ways people explain events, i.e., that attributions cause these dispositions. [19] An optimist would view defeat as temporary, as something that does not apply to other cases, and as something that is not their fault. [20] Measures of attributional style distinguish three dimensions among explanations for events: Whether these explanations draw on internal versus external causes; whether the causes are viewed as stable versus unstable; and whether explanations apply globally versus being situationally specific. In addition, the measures distinguish attributions for positive and negative events.

Positive mental attitude Half a glass of water, illustration of two different mental attitudes, optimism (half full) and pessimism (half empty)There is much debate about the relationship between explanatory style and optimism. Some researchers argue that optimism is simply the lay-term for what researchers know as explanatory style. [23] More commonly, it is found that explanatory style is distinct from dispositional optimism, [24] so the two should not be used interchangeably as they are marginally correlated at best. More research is required to "bridge" or further differentiate these concepts. Another study conducted by Aspinwall and Taylor (1990) [ full citation needed] assessed incoming freshmen on a range of personality factors such as optimism, self-esteem, locus of self-control, etc. [42] Freshmen who scored high on optimism before entering college had lower levels of psychological distress than their more pessimistic peers while controlling for the other personality factors. Over time, the more optimistic students were less stressed, less lonely, and less depressed than their pessimistic counterparts.
